Form 4: Alkami Chief Legal Officer Sells Shares for Tax Obligations
Insider Transaction Report
Alkami Technology's Chief Legal Officer, Douglas A. Linebarger, sold 8,242 shares of common stock to cover tax withholding obligations related to RSU vesting.
Summary
- Douglas A. Linebarger, Chief Legal Officer of Alkami Technology, Inc. (ALKT), disposed of 8,242 shares of common stock on September 2, 2025.
- The shares were sold at a price of $24.76 per share.
- This transaction was a "sell to cover" to satisfy tax withholding obligations arising from the vesting and settlement of Restricted Stock Units (RSUs).
- The sale was not a discretionary transaction by Mr. Linebarger.
- Following this transaction, Mr. Linebarger beneficially owns 229,930 shares of Alkami Technology common stock.

Industry Context
This is a routine insider transaction (Form 4) related to executive compensation and tax obligations, common across all industries for publicly traded companies where executives receive equity as part of their compensation package. It does not reflect specific industry trends for financial technology or software companies.
